首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php 当前月份

基础概念

PHP是一种广泛使用的开源脚本语言,特别适用于Web开发。它可以嵌入HTML代码中,用于创建动态网页内容。PHP提供了丰富的函数库,可以用来处理日期和时间。

相关优势

  1. 易于学习:PHP语法简单,适合初学者。
  2. 广泛支持:几乎所有的主流操作系统都支持PHP。
  3. 丰富的资源:有大量的开源库和框架可供使用。
  4. 社区支持:有一个活跃的开发者社区,可以快速找到解决问题的方法。

类型

PHP中的日期和时间处理函数主要分为以下几类:

  • 日期和时间函数:如date()strtotime()等。
  • 时区处理函数:如date_default_timezone_set()date_default_timezone_get()等。
  • 日期时间间隔函数:如strtotime()结合加减操作。

应用场景

在Web开发中,PHP的日期和时间处理功能常用于:

  • 显示当前日期和时间。
  • 计算两个日期之间的差异。
  • 格式化日期和时间。
  • 处理时区转换。

示例代码

以下是一个简单的PHP代码示例,用于获取并显示当前月份:

代码语言:txt
复制
<?php
// 设置默认时区为东八区(北京时间)
date_default_timezone_set('Asia/Shanghai');

// 获取当前月份
$currentMonth = date('m');

echo "当前月份是:" . $currentMonth;
?>

参考链接

常见问题及解决方法

问题:为什么我的PHP脚本无法正确显示当前月份?

原因

  1. 时区设置不正确:如果未正确设置时区,可能会导致日期和时间显示错误。
  2. 函数使用错误:使用了错误的日期和时间函数或参数。

解决方法

  1. 确保在使用日期和时间函数之前设置了正确的时区:
  2. 确保在使用日期和时间函数之前设置了正确的时区:
  3. 检查使用的函数和参数是否正确,例如:
  4. 检查使用的函数和参数是否正确,例如:

通过以上步骤,你应该能够正确获取并显示当前月份。如果问题仍然存在,请检查PHP配置文件(php.ini)中的相关设置,并确保PHP版本是最新的。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PHP获取当前时间、年份、月份、日期和天数

获取当前时间,需要用到 PHP Date() 函数。 PHP Date() 把时间戳格式化为更易读的日期和时间。...March) M - 表示月份(3个字母:Jun) m - 表示月份,有前导0(数字:04) n - 表示月份,无前导0(数字:4) d - 表示月份中的第几天,有前导0(01-31) j -  表示月份中的第几天...php     echo checkdate(6, 25, 2017);//1 ?> time:获取当前时间戳 获取当前时间戳通过 time() 函数来实现。声明如下: int time(); php     echo time();//获取当前时间的时间戳 ?> 通过 PHP mktime() 创建日期 date() 函数中可选的时间戳参数规定时间戳。...php echo date("Y")?> 声明:本文由w3h5原创,转载请注明出处:《PHP获取当前时间、年份、月份、日期和天数》 https://www.w3h5.com/post/268.html

24.3K10
  • DedeCMS 显示当前访问用户地区PHP调用方法

    DedeCMS 显示当前访问用户地区PHP调用方法 ---- 当前访问用户地域显示 PHP 方法,打开/include/extend.func.php,在最下面增加一下代码。...$ip){ if(empty($ip)){ return '缺少用户ip'; } $url = 'HTTPs://sp0.baidu.com/8aQDcjqpAAV3otqbppnN2DJv/api.php...类型 $str=$str->data[0]->location; //取出数据 return $str; } 模板调用方法如下,如果调用失效,找到系统设置 -> 其他设置 -> 模板引擎禁用标签,删除 PHP...保存即可: {dede:php} $str=check_address(GetIp());//GetIP()为当前访问用户的真实IP(xxx.xxx.xxx.xxx),输入结果为“广东省珠海市 中国移动...市 ');//从'市'左侧结束,当然可以保留该字符,从空格左侧开始,如' ' echo $s = mb_substr($str,$t1,$t2-$t1); //输出结果为“广东省珠海” {/dede:php

    4.8K30
    领券